What they do

ALLAMAKEE-CLAYTON ELECTRIC COOPERATIVE is DEDICATED to ENHANCING THE QUALITY of LIFE for OUR MEMBERS, PARTNERS and NEIGHBORS BY PROVIDING SAFE, RELIABLE and AFFORDABLE ELECTRIC SERVICES and OTHER INNOVATIVE SOLUTIONS.
